Trading Platforms
MetaTrader 4 (MT4)
FXTM provides access to one of the most popular trading platforms in the industry, MetaTrader 4. Renowned for its user-friendly interface, robust functionality, and reliability, MT4 at FXTM allows traders to explore a wide array of trading instruments with enhanced trading features. The platform supports multiple order types, provides a vast array of analytical tools, including 30 built-in technical indicators and 24 graphic objects, and offers automated trading capabilities through Expert Advisors (EAs).
MetaTrader 5 (MT5)
Building on the success of MT4, FXTM also offers MetaTrader 5, which caters to traders looking for additional features and extended possibilities. MT5 includes all the admired features of MT4 but with added functionalities such as more technical indicators, more chart time frames, an economic calendar integrated directly into the platform, and enhanced order execution capabilities. MT5 at FXTM is particularly appealing to experienced traders who require greater depth in their trading and analysis.
FXTM Trader App
For those who prefer trading on the go, FXTM’s mobile app, FXTM Trader, offers a comprehensive and easy-to-navigate interface. Available on both Android and iOS, the app includes most of the functionalities available on desktop versions, such as real-time quotes, charting tools, and the ability to open and close positions at a moment’s notice. The mobile app ensures that FXTM traders can manage their accounts and trade from anywhere at any time.
Tradable Assets
FXTM boasts a diverse range of tradable assets that cater to the varying preferences of traders. These include:
Forex: FXTM stands out with a strong emphasis on forex trading, offering major, minor, and exotic currency pairs. This allows traders to capitalize on forex market fluctuations with a broad choice of pairs.
Indices, Commodities, and Shares: Besides forex, FXTM offers trading in indices, commodities, and shares. This includes access to major indices such as the Dow Jones, FTSE 100, and NASDAQ, among others. Commodities trading includes metals like gold and silver, energy commodities such as oil and gas, and a variety of agricultural products.
Cryptocurrencies: In response to growing demand, FXTM has also incorporated cryptocurrency CFDs into its asset offerings, providing traders with the option to trade on the price movements of major cryptocurrencies without the need for actual ownership.
Account Types
FXTM provides multiple account types to suit various trading styles and levels of experience:
Standard Account: Designed for traders who prefer traditional trading, the Standard Account offers tight floating spreads, instant execution, and no commissions on forex, precious metals, and commodities. This account is suitable for those new to trading as well as experienced traders who prefer a straightforward approach.
Cent Account: Ideal for beginners, the Cent Account allows traders to trade smaller lot sizes and open positions with just a few cents. This account type helps new traders gain experience in real-market conditions without a significant initial investment.
Shares Account: For those interested in trading shares, the Shares Account provides direct access to more than 180 U.S. shares with real-time data straight from NYSE and NASDAQ. No commissions are charged, and the account offers instant execution.
ECN Accounts: FXTM’s ECN Accounts are tailored for advanced traders looking for tight spreads and fast market execution. The ECN Zero and ECN Pro Accounts offer different benefits, including lower spreads and more currency pairs.

FXTM, or ForexTime, is an international online forex and CFD broker that provides trading services and platforms for various financial instruments including forex, indices, commodities, and shares.
Yes, FXTM is regulated by several reputable financial authorities, including the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C), the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) in the UK, and other local regulatory bodies in the jurisdictions they operate.
FXTM offers a variety of account types to suit different trading strategies and levels of investment. These include the Standard Account, Cent Account, Shares Account, and ECN Account, each with unique features and benefits.
FXTM offers multiple deposit methods including bank wire transfers, credit/debit cards, and e-wallets such as Skrill, NETELLER, and WebMoney. The availability of these methods can vary by region.
FXTM does not charge any fees for deposits. However, withdrawals can incur charges depending on the method used and the transaction size. It’s advisable to check the latest fees on FXTM’s official website or contact their customer support for detailed information.
FXTM ensures the security of client funds through several measures, including using segregated accounts to keep clients’ funds separate from the company’s operational funds, employing SSL encryption for data transfer, and adhering to strict regulatory guidelines.
FXTM primarily offers the industry-standard MetaTrader 4 (MT4) and MetaTrader 5 (MT5) platforms, which are available for desktop, web, and mobile devices.
